2. He debuted as a singer at the age of 17.

Armed with two years of training, Lee Seung Gi made his entertainment debut in 2004 with a song composed by PSY (aka the man behind "Gangnam Style"), titled "You're My Woman." The track is about a noona romance (or a young man falling in love with an older woman). It became a popular hit in South Korea, which eventually earned him a number of "Best Newcomer" awards.

3. Lee Seung Gi has starred in a string of successful K-dramas.

If you remember Lee Seung Gi in the Koreanovelas Brilliant Legacy and My Girlfriend Is A Gumiho, congrats, you're already a tita like me. Aside from this, he has also led a handful of high-rating K-dramas such as The King 2 Hearts, Gu Family Book (also known as Kangchi, The Beginning), A Korean Odyssey, and Vagabond. 7. In school, he was a well-rounded student.

It was said that in high school, he became the student body president, played soccer, and led a rock band as a vocalist. In college, he was admitted to Dongguk University and in a TV show, it was revealed that he received straight As in class! Lee Seung Gi also pursued his masters at Dongguk University’s Graduate School where he studied content planning. 9. The Hallyu star represented South Korea in the 2012 London Olympics.

Along with Han Ga In, Seung Gi served as a runner and torchbearer in the Olympics. He was chosen as the country's representative not only because he's an endorser of Samsung (who sponsored the Olympics) at that time, but also because of his overall good image. A good choice indeed!

10. He dated Girls' Generation's Yoona seven years ago.

On January 1, 2014, Lee Seung Gi and Yoona were revealed by Dispatch as a New Year's Couple. It turns out, they started dating in October 2013! Seung Gi has mentioned several times that the Girls' Generation member is his ideal type. Imagine how happy fans were when they were confirmed to be in a relationship! Seung Gi was once spotted picking up Yoona from her house and they went on a romantic date by the Han River. Kilig! Unfortunately, they broke up in August 2015.
